New bus lanes for Remuera
Wednesday, 20 February 2008
Bus lanes will be introduced on Remuera and St Johns roads following a decision by Auckland City Council’s transport committee.

Special customer night - Thursday November 22
Wednesday, 21 November 2007
Remuera shops are combining to do a special customer night on Thursday, November 22.  Many of the stores will be offering discounts on the night and Christmas nibbles to make the shopping experience more enjoyable.  The majority of stores will be open until at least 7pm, many as late as 8pm.
